When I taught physics in the public high schools of South Bend, Indiana, we covered conduction, convection, and radiation. I began the discussion on conduction by asking why we wear clothes, outside of the obvious one. The thermal conductivity of various kinds of clothing helps us stay warm in winter and cool in summer. For example, goose down is a good insulator because it holds pockets of air, and air does not conduct heat well. Likewise, the design of skin and hair involves thermal conductivity, which is why being immersed in cold water takes heat out of our bodies rapidly, causing hypothermia.

Fat is another insulating material, and having very little fat in one’s body can cause rapid heat loss. Even the color of one’s skin or hair can make a difference. One of the experiments that I had my students do was to take two identical cans and paint one black and the other white. We would then put boiling water in each can and measure the temperature of the can every minute, graphing the cooling curve of the two cans. The black can would cool much faster than the white can; in this case, the cooling is by radiation, another heat transfer method. We all know that black objects absorb heat from sunlight better than white objects. Therefore, black things also release heat more rapidly.
